§ 22-38c — Expand and grow Connecticut agriculture account.
There shall be an expand and grow Connecticut agriculture account, which shall be a separate, nonlapsing account within the General Fund. Funds received pursuant to sections 22-38a and 26-194 shall be deposited into said account. The Commissioner of Agriculture shall make payments from said account to fund the program established in section 22-38a.

Legislative History
(P.A. 04-222, S. 8; P.A. 06-187, S. 66; P.A. 24-100, S. 3.) History: P.A. 04-222 effective July 1, 2004; P.A. 06-187 added references to Sec. 22-38a and provided for mandatory payments to expand and grow Connecticut agriculture account, effective July 1, 2006; P.A. 24-100 deleted reference to Sec. 22-38b and made a technical change, effective June 4, 2024.
